Until we ended up with as much or a little ae86 as possible
http://i74.photobucket.com/albums/i2...n/DSC01315.jpg
We started by welding up all the holes that would leave tyre smoke or rain water into the cockpit
http://i74.photobucket.com/albums/i2...n/DSC01316.jpg
http://assets.speedhunters.com/Image...itled-4942.jpg
Then we fabricated the rear strut bar that will be integrated into the rollcage and also the rear chassis bar
http://i74.photobucket.com/albums/i2...n/DSC01317.jpg
http://assets.speedhunters.com/Image...itled-4932.jpg
We then started to position the centre hoop so we could fab the platforms for it to sit on
http://i74.photobucket.com/albums/i2...n/DSC01313.jpg
http://i74.photobucket.com/albums/i2...n/DSC01314.jpg
http://assets.speedhunters.com/Image...itled-4985.jpg
We moved to the front then as we had no where to mount our tension rods and anti roll bar so we fabbed a new front chassis section from scratch
